学数据结构和算法要学高数么?

我是说,不学高数没法学计算机编程算法?

我学的是计算机和数学的交叉课程!总结一下,如果你不是做研究和向很前沿发展:
1.数据结构和算法很重要。
2. 高等数学对数据结构基本没有帮助,但并不一定非要学!离散数学有用!

3. 你看得算法和应用的书,直接看大学教材《数据结构》就可以,通篇都是C语言的举例,很好懂,和数学关系很小

4. 阅读优秀的源代码很多时候都只能理解里面的小技巧,对作者的构思没有系统的学过设计话你是参悟不到的,因此一边读代码一边看书都可以

另外数据结构真的不难,也不需要懂太多数学知识,其实大部分都是基础算法,建议你安装一个标C的编译器,按照教材多学多做,很快就能掌握了

现在实际上应用的数据结构专门知识其实很少,大部分都是简单应用
温馨提示:答案为网友推荐,仅供参考
第1个回答  2010-04-17
高数和数据结构和算法没有必然的关系! 如果不是像教授搞研究一样,一般高深的数学知识是用不上的,中学的数学知识足够研究长见的算法了! 你可以先去学数据结构和算法,不用想太多,行动就是,用着数学了再说!
相似回答